Halloween - Bleeding Heart Cupcakes

Jack and Jack Jr. get together to have some halloween fun. The make Bleeding Heart Cupcakes. Here is the recipe: BLEEDING HEART CUP CAKES / FUNNY BONES * 20 glass marbles or small balls of tinfoil * 1 recipe batter for White Cake mix * 2 to 3 cups strawberry jelly or smooth strawberry jam * 1 recipe Vanilla Butter Cream Frosting or buy it * Red and blue food coloring * Pastry bag and medium round tip (optional) * * preparation * * 1. Line cupcake tins with paper liners. Fill the liners two-thirds full with the batter. Place 1 marble or tinfoil ball between each liner and the tin. This will make a dent in your cupcake when it bakes to make it heart-shaped. Bake the cupcakes as directed in the recipe . If you are using marbles, be careful when removing the cupcakes from the tins because the marbles will be very hot. 2. With a small paring knife, cut out a circle about the size of a dime in the center of each cupcake, going about two thirds of the way in. Pull the little plug of cake out. Cut off the top of this piece (about 1/2 inch thick) and eat or discard the bottom. Use a teaspoon or a squeeze bottle to fill the hole partway with the strawberry jelly "blood." Put the little cake plug back in. Continue with the rest of the hearts. 3. Put one third of the frosting into two separate bowls. Color one bowl of frosting with the red food coloring. Confetti Blood and Goo Halloween Cupcake Recipe

This is a fast and easy Halloween cupcake recipe anyone can reproduce. Decorating items such as candies, frosting and food coloring can be substituted to accommodate all your holiday cake and cupcake recipes. 1 - red velvet cake mix 1/3 - veg oil 1 1/3 - cup water 3 - eggs 1 - ready made chocolate frosting 1 - ready made vanilla frosting Green Food Coloring Dye Festive food candy piece ideas Festive Halloween sprinkles ideas Foil cupcake baking cups Baking sheet Pastry bag w/tip Electric Mixer Small Pot Blend, mix and bake according to the manufacturers instructions on box cake mix. Add 20 drops of food coloring to vanilla frosting and blend well. Pour icing into pastry decorating bag w/tip and fill cooled baked cupcakes by pressing in the top center and squeeze until the cupcakes puff up and icing oozes out. Melt the chocolate frosting over low heat and pour over cupcakes. Top with your favorite festive Halloween candies.
